Suzuki Khyber Overview

Introduction

In 1989, the automotive landscape in Pakistan was forever changed with the arrival of the 1st Generation Suzuki Khyber. This front-engine, front-wheel-drive subcompact hatchback quickly stole hearts and earned a special place in the hearts of Pakistani car enthusiasts. Offered in three distinct variants – GA, Plus, and Limited Edition – the Khyber became a household name. However, in 1999, Pak Suzuki decided to conclude production, leaving behind a legacy that continues to endure. Exterior

The 1st Generation Suzuki Khyber boasts a distinctive exterior design language. Up front, it flaunts trapezium headlights, a petite rectangular grille with quad intakes, a boldly protruding black bumper, and a rectangular air intake. At the rear, you’ll find trapezium side-swept taillights, another assertive black bumper, and the hallmark of a standard hatchback. The Khyber’s overall exterior presentation stands out remarkably amongst its competitors, making a strong impression in the local market. Notably, all variants of the Suzuki Khyber share identical styling elements.

Interior

Stepping inside the 1st Generation Suzuki Khyber, you’ll encounter a blend of light gray, dark gray, and black plastic trim pieces. Fabric-clad front and rear seats provide comfortable seating. Standard interior features encompass air conditioning and foldable rear seats. Impressively, every aspect of the car’s controls is operated manually. However, it’s important to note that the overall interior space for this hatchback’s exterior dimensions is adequate but not overly generous, and comfort and refinement levels are modest.

Engine and Performance

Under the hood, the Suzuki Khyber houses a robust 1.0-liter 4-stroke cycle water-cooled SOHC 12-valve Inline-3 engine, capable of producing 100bhp@6000RPM. The power is channeled through a responsive 5-speed manual transmission, ensuring an engaging driving experience.
